river basin, basin, watershed, drainage basin, catchment area, catchment basin, drainage area (noun) the entire geographical area drained by a river and its tributaries; an area characterized by all runoff being conveyed to the same outlet. drainage basin: see catchment areacatchment area or drainage basin, area drained by a stream or other body of water. Despite its popularity, most applications of the 2SFCA method are limited by the utilisation of only a single catchment size within a small geographic area. Some of this water stays underground and continues to slowly feed the river in times of low rainfall. What does Catchment mean? Definition of catchment-area noun in Oxford Advanced American Dictionary. the area of land from which water flows into a river, lake, or reservoir: There has been a lot of recent rainfall in the catchment area of the river. A catchment area is the geographic area for which a facility attracts clients or customers. In human geography, a catchment area is the area from which a city, service or institution attracts a population that uses its services. The Dartmouth Atlas Group uses hospital referral regions (HRRs) and hospital service areas (HSAs). There have been many attempts to define a hospital's catchment area. "Catchment Area (Health)" is a descriptor in the National Library of Medicine's controlled vocabulary thesaurus, MeSH (Medical Subject Headings).Descriptors are arranged in a hierarchical structure, which enables searching at various levels of specificity. In the United States, catchment areas are defined by zip codes and are based on an area of approximately 40 miles in radius for inpatient care and 20 miles in radius for ambulatory care. Definition of Catchment in the Definitions.net dictionary. A catchment area is the geographic area for which a facility attracts clients or customers. In the first phase, Gurugram forest department has developed two catchment areas ( Bhood) in Ghamdoz and Manesar in the shape of small lakes to conserve water during monsoons. For example, a school catchment area is the geographic area from which students are eligible to attend a local school.